Personal data Carolus Cornelis "Karel" Bedaux 

  • Nickname is Karel.
  • He was born on May 11, 1903 in Tilburg.

  • He died on March 26, 1981 in Tilburg, he was 77 years old.
  • A child of Georgius Mattheus Jacobus Bedaux and Joanna Maria Elisabeth Janssen

Notes about Carolus Cornelis "Karel" Bedaux

Karel was lid van de orde van de Missionarissen van het Hl. Hart
